CF is seeking a Business Development Consultant in Greater London to enhance commercial relationships in the healthcare sector. The role demands expertise in business development, with responsibilities including engaging with senior client stakeholders, developing proposals, and supporting business strategy.
Candidates should have over 2 years in relevant roles and strong technical and analytical skills. Flexible working options are available, promoting a balanced work-life environment.
